Course Content

• Urban Nature & Wellbeing: Exploring the restorative power of green spaces for senior mental and physical health.
• Designing Age-Friendly Urban Nature: Accessibility, universal design, and inclusive green spaces for seniors.
• Nature-Based Interventions for Seniors: Therapeutic horticulture, forest bathing, and other evidence-based practices.
• Community Gardening and Urban Agriculture for Seniors: Building social connections and improving food security through shared urban green spaces.
• Urban Ecology and Biodiversity for Seniors: Understanding the interconnectedness of urban ecosystems and their importance for wellbeing.
• Planning and Advocacy for Urban Nature: Engaging in local initiatives to improve urban green spaces and advocate for senior needs.
• Sustainable Practices in Urban Greening: Implementing environmentally sound practices in urban nature projects.
• Urban Nature Connection and Cognitive Function in Seniors: Exploring the impact of nature on memory, attention, and cognitive decline.
